WebThe average size for a burbot is 15 to 22 inches long and one to three pounds. It may attain a weight of 12 pounds. ... The burbot lives in Lake Michigan and in streams. It prefers deep water. The burbot is active at night. Spawning in winter, the female scatters eggs over the bottom. Eggs hatch after three or four weeks. The burbot eats fishes ...
